Web26 sep. 2024 · Step 1. Write the title of the ledger book on the front or inside cover of the book. List the time period it covers as well, such as for a year or quarter (every three months). Step 2. List the column headings you need for your ledger book on a separate piece of paper before you start writing them in. As previously mentioned, we not only have the general ledger, but also two other subsidiary or supporting ledgers: - The Debtors Ledger - The Creditors Ledger. We also learned that all individual debtor T-accounts go in the debtors ledger and all individual creditor T-accounts go in the creditors ledger. For example, here is a debtor's ledger …

Web8 jan. 2024 · Cash Disbursement Journal is a special journal used to record all payments of cash, also called Cash Payment Journal. This is a journal that we could use if we were to set up the accounting process by hand rather than having a computer system, like QuickBooks. The Cash Disbursement Journal will work best when there are just a few …
